Does anyone ever read these things? Would love to get some input on a few questions... I am a first-time dieter - was always a tiny person 'til middle age and now, you know, it catches up with you... (!) I decided to get back to a healthy weight for me this past spring and managed to lose 20+ pounds over about half a year of following a modified sort of 5:2 diet, and exercise, and I have felt really good. So, circumstances meant that I recently took a month off of this new eating/exercising regime and I gained 5 pounds back during that time. But in the space of just a few days I seem to have shed it off again. So one question, if I can word it correctly, is some thing like this: IF you eat a lot one day, it will certainly show up on the scale the next day. Does weight/fat sort of fix into place after a while? Throughout my dieting time, I have certainly had days where I ate a lot - far too much. And the loss was pretty slow, but pretty steady (with a few plateaus along the way). And the regain was relatively fast. But it seems like, I don't know, the fact that the regained weight wasn't allowed to "settle" made it really easy to slough off again. Does that make any sense?
